What is an entry level AWS Devops?

Entry Level AWS DevOps roles are positions for individuals who are beginning their careers in DevOps and cloud computing, specifically working with Amazon Web Services (AWS). These roles typically involve assisting in automating deployment processes, managing cloud infrastructure, and supporting software development teams in building, testing, and deploying applications on AWS. Entry-level professionals often work under the guidance of senior engineers to learn about continuous integration/contin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ines, infrastructure as code, and monitoring cloud environments. Strong foundational knowledge of Linux, scripting, and basic AWS services is usually required. These positions provide a pathway to more advanced DevOps and cloud engineering roles as skills and experience grow.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level AWS Devops engineer?

To thrive as an Entry Level AWS DevOps Engineer, you generally need foundational knowledge of cloud computing, basic programming or scripting skills (such as Python or Bash), and familiarity with the software development lifecycle. Hands-on experience with AWS services, CI/CD tools like Jenkins or GitHub Actions, and relevant certifications such as A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ner are highly valued. Strong problem-solving, collaboration, and adaptability help you work effectively in dynamic team environments and troubleshoot issues quickly. These skills are crucial for ensuring reliable cloud infrastructure, efficient automation, and seamless deployment processes.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level AWS Devops engineers, and how can they overcome them?

Entry-level AWS DevOps engineers often face challenges such as learning to manage complex cloud infrastructure, automating deployment pipelines, and troubleshooting issues in distributed environments. To overcome these, it's essential to build a solid understanding of core AWS services, practice using Infrastructure as Code tools like CloudFormation or Terraform, and actively seek mentorship from more experienced team members. Regular collaboration with developers and operations teams can also help in gaining practical insights and improving problem-solving skills. Continuous learning and hands-on experimentation are key to growing in this fast-paced field.

What is the difference between Entry Level Aws Devops vs Entry Level Cloud Engineer?

AspectEntry Level Aws DevopsEntry Level Cloud Engineer
CertificationsAWS Certified DevOps Engineer – Associate, AWS Certified Solutions Architect – AssociateAWS Certified Solutions Architect – Associate, Microsoft Azure Fundamentals
Work EnvironmentFocus on automation, CI/CD pipelines, and deployment in AWSBroader cloud platform management, including AWS, Azure, or GCP
Employer UsageTech companies, startups, and organizations adopting DevOps practices on AWSOrganizations implementing multi-cloud or cloud infrastructure management

While both roles involve cloud technologies, Entry Level Aws Devops specializes in automation, deployment, and continuous integration within AWS environments. Entry Level Cloud Engineer has a broader scope, managing various cloud platforms and infrastructure. The choice depends on whether you prefer a specialized DevOps focus or a more general cloud engineering role.

Can I get an entry level AWS DevOps job with no experience?

Entry level AWS DevOps positions typically require some foundational knowledge of cloud computing, Linux, scripting, and tools like Docker or Jenkins. While prior experience is not always mandatory, candidates often need relevant certifications, such as A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ner, and demonstrate understanding of automation and deployment processes to be competitive.

How to get an entry level AWS DevOps job with no experience?

To secure an entry-level AWS DevOps position with no experience, focus on gaining foundational knowledge of cloud computing, Linux, scripting, and automation tools like Jenkins or Terraform. Earning relevant certifications such as A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ner or AWS Certified DevOps Engineer can also improve your chances, along with building hands-on skills through personal projects or internships.
